LOW TESTOSTERONE-GET IT CHECKED!
A couple of weeks ago I went to my doctor to get a prescription for Viagra. I am 57 years old, and I had been having some trouble with both having an erection, and sustaining it. I am not ashamed at all to admit this or talk about it, many male friends have told me they use Viagra.
I actually had called one of those phone numbers advertised on radio these days, promoting Viagra without a a doctor visit, and chickened out when it sounded like I was talking to one of those prison phone order banks you read about. Anyway, I ended up going to my physician. The doctor asked me a number of questions, among them, had I been feeling listless and tired, had I gained a little weight at the waistline, and had I perceived some change in my voice, in addition to erectile disfunction. I had to answer in the affirmative to all questions. I took a blood test that day, which revealed extremely low testosterone, and also high cholesterol.
The low testosterone levels did not surprise me, I had been born with an undescended testicle, which caused some blood drainage problems from by scrotum, and this condition had to be corrected with surgery when I was 40. I also have had prostatitis from time to time, since I was in my thirties. What really alarmed me was the cholesterol being high, because that has never been the case, and I had had it checked on numerous occasions.
As it turns out, low testosterone can cause a changed metabolic rate which will lead to increased cholesterol in the blood, the two are related.
According to the doctor, millions of men are out there with low testosterone levels, and it is quite treatable without side effects. I am now using a gel which I rub onto my arms and shoulders each morning which should over the next few weeks begin to make changes in my energy level and metabolic rate. I'll keep you posted.
In case you're interested, the gel is called AndroGel, and is made by UNIMED Pharmaceuticals, Inc., Marietta Georgia.
